Bonnie has been driven by the rhythm of the drum since she was a young girl, loving all styles of music and getting her first drum set when she was 11 years old. Drumming and singing in the school band and choir built her confidence, sense of passion and self esteem. As a young adult, she played in the music club scene and continues to perform professionally in classic rock and R& B bands.
As a former Child & Youth Counselor working with children and youth who struggle socially, emotionally and behaviorally, Bonnie used the hand drum to reach the hearts and souls of many. She continues to facilitate Divine Drumming Programs in her private practice, offering drum circles, therapeutic drumming courses and retreats and knows that the drum is responsible for her own healing and true sense of passion for life.
